🍷 Ferngrove Independence Pinot Noir is an inviting expression of the varietal, showcasing a mid cherry red hue with subtle purple highlights. It stands out with its lifted aromas of black cherry, raspberry, and licorice, complemented by earthy undertones.

Produced by Ferngrove Wines in Western Australia, this Pinot Noir is known for its balanced complexity and approachable style. The region's consistent weather and the winery's patient winemaking process contribute to its distinctive character.

The palate is medium-bodied, offering fresh red berry and strawberry notes with a delicate herbal, stalky finish. It combines a supple texture with a hint of spices and cloves, finishing with long grainy tannins.

This wine is perfectly suited for a variety of occasions, balancing freshness with a soft, lingering acidity.
